If you were pulled over and refused or failed the Breathalyzer test, your driver's license will be automatically suspended unless you challenge the suspension at an Administrative License Revocation (ALR) hearing. You have only 15 days from your arrest to request an ALR hearing with the Texas Department of Public Safety.

The ALR Hearing Is Critical

If you do not request an ALR hearing before the deadline, your license will be automatically suspended on the 40th day following your arrest, and you will lose your opportunity to apply for an occupational license. The length of the suspension depends on the charge you are facing. For a first DWI charge, the suspension is typically up to two years.

At the ALR hearing, we will contest the license suspension. We may also question the arresting officer about the circumstances of your arrest. This can be a key part of your defense if the criminal part of your DWI case goes to trial.

If your license is suspended at the hearing, we can help you apply for an occupational license if you are eligible. An occupational license allows you to drive to work, to school and to perform household duties.
